@charset "UTF-8";/* import   --------------------------------------------- *//* ベース */@import "base.css";/* コンテンツ   --------------------------------------------- */   #ind_header {	width: 920px;	height: 40px;	background-image: url(../img/00index_img/index_header.jpg);}#ind_header_r {	width: 505px;	height: 18px;	float:right;	font-size: 13px;	margin: 22px 15px 0 0;	text-align: right;	font-weight: bold;}#ind_header_r a {	color: #074D4C;	text-decoration: none;}#ind_header_r a:hover {	color: #FF0000;	text-decoration: none;}#ind_header_l {	width: 400px;	float:left;	text-indent: -9999px;}#ind_content {	width: 870px;	height:auto;	margin: 30px 25px 5px 25px;	background-color: #FFFFFF;}#content_l a:hover {	color: #C8190D;}	/* コンテンツ左   --------------------------------------------- */   #rollover01 {	width:450px;	height:90px;	background:url(../img/00index_img/index_title01a.png);	margin-bottom: 5px;}#rollover01 a {	display:block;}#rollover01 a:hover {text-indent:-9999px;}#rollover02 {	width:450px;	height:90px;	background:url(../img/00index_img/index_title02a.png);	margin-bottom: 5px;}#rollover02 a {	display:block;}#rollover02 a:hover {text-indent:-9999px;}#rollover03 {	width:450px;	height:90px;	background:url(../img/00index_img/index_title03a.png);	margin-bottom: 5px;}#rollover03 a {	display:block;}#rollover03 a:hover {text-indent:-9999px;}#rollover04 {	width:450px;	height:60px;	background:url(../img/00index_img/index_title04a.png);	margin-bottom: 5px;}#rollover04 a {	display:block;}#rollover04 a:hover {text-indent:-9999px;}#rollover_btnbox {	width:379px;	height:50px;	background:url(../img/00index_img/btn_index01a.png);	margin-top: 15px;}   #rollover_btn01 {	width:184px;	height:50px;	background:url(../img/00index_img/btn_index01a.png);	float: left;}#rollover_btn01 a {	display:block;}#rollover_btn01 a:hover {text-indent:-9999px;}#rollover_btn02 {	width:184px;	height:50px;	background:url(../img/00index_img/btn_index02a.png);	float: right;}#rollover_btn02 a {	display:block;}#rollover_btn02 a:hover {text-indent:-9999px;}#content_l {	float: left;	width: 450px;	font-size: 13px;	line-height: 19px;	color: #51B6B5;}#content_l a {	color: #666;	text-decoration: none;}#content_l a:hover {	color: #FF0000;	text-decoration: underline;}#content_l ul {	margin:0;	padding:0;}#content_l li {	float: left;	width: 450px;	margin: 0 20px 20px 0;}#content_l li p {	font-size: 14px;	font-weight: bold;	padding: 7px 0 5px 0;}#content_l li p a {	color: #F97C02;	text-decoration: none;}/* コンテンツ右（新着情報）   --------------------------------------------- */   #content_r {	float: right;	width: 379px;}#news {	width: 379px;	margin-top: 20px;	font-size: 13px;	line-height: 19px;	color: #B87142;	background-image: url(../img/00index_img/index_new_back.jpg);}#content_r ul {	margin:0;	padding:0;}#content_r li {	margin:10px 20px;	padding-top:10px;	list-style-type:none;	border-top: 1px dotted #FF3366;}  #content_r b {	font-size: 12px;	color: #8A4B22;	font-family: "Times New Roman", Times, serif;	font-style: italic;}	#content_r a {	color: #C8190D;	text-decoration: underline;}#news_title {	background-image: url(../img/news.jpg);	text-indent: -9999px;	height: 51px;	width: 108px;}#news_bottom {	background-image: url(../img/00index_img/index_new_back2.jpg);	text-indent: -9999px;	height: 20px;	width: 379px;	margin-bottom: 20px;}